Dense Wavelength Division Multiplexing Equipment Market Size is USD 12.8 Billion in 2025

The global Dense Wavelength Division Multiplexing Equipment market size was valued at approximately USD 12.8 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 24.4 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 6.3% during the forecast period. Dense Wavelength Division Multiplexing (DWDM) technology involves multiplexing multiple optical carrier signals on a single optical fiber by using different wavelengths of laser light. This technology is a fundamental component in optical communications, providing high-capacity transmission across existing fiber networks, and is instrumental in expanding bandwidth capabilities globally.
